Hi all,

My father is in Moz at the moment and his NL 90lt stopped working. on 12v or 220v the Fault ID light stays on. I tried to check for him in the trouble shooting but it only mention flashing ID codes.

Any help please?

Wayne,
The only problem I had was a poor connection between the fridge power plug where it is plugged into the vehicle power or 220v power. Fiddle with the connections and that should tell you if it is getting intermittent power. I replaced my connections and it now works perfectly again...
